Notice Title
Consultants to provide a range of services to establish a fishing fund
Notice Description
Consultants to provide a range of services to establish a fishing fund which will provide a mechanism to enable the offshore wind industry to provide grants to the fishing industry. This is a voluntary initiative being progressed by Crown Estate Scotland, in collaboration with offshore wind developers, the fishing industry and Marine Scotland. The objective of the fund is to provide a mechanism which enables the offshore wind industry in Scotland to provide grants to the fishing industry to support projects which deliver against broad thematic aims (to be defined by steering group, examples include health & safety, education, sustainability and just transition). The fund is entirely distinct from the consenting process and any associated mitigation or compensation.

Lot 1
Crown Estate Scotland is seeking to appoint Consultants to provide a range of services to establish a fishing fund which will provide a mechanism to enable the offshore wind industry to provide grants to the fishing industry. The fund is currently at an early inception stage. Crown Estate Scotland is seeking support services to develop the structure and governance arrangements for the fund in collaboration with key stakeholders. The support services include the following: - Facilitation of and secretariat for a funders group of representatives from Crown Estate Scotland and offshore wind developers to discuss key elements of the fund. It is expected that this group would meet 3 times over the course of the project. Key topics are expected to include: - approach to funding contributions - to include developer funding levels and the development of a flexible approach to accommodate funding coming from different corporate entities (i.e. developers vs project companies) and at different project stages (e.g. project companies may only provide funding when a project has reached construction stage). - Establishment, facilitation and secretariat for a steering group comprised of the funders group, plus fishing industry representatives and Marine Scotland, expected to meet approximately monthly. Key topics are expected to include: - fund objectives; - stakeholder engagement; - development of eligibility criteria to support decision making related to the award of grants (note these are expected to be reviewed annually to ensure no unintended consequences and no duplication with other funding initiatives); - Development of potential governance structures for the fund to include the legal entity of the fund e.g. SCIO or third party administrator, as well as the operational governance e.g. steering group, funding panel etc. - An assessment of benefits and risks associated with each potential structure. - Identification of the preferred governance structure for the fund and actions required to set up the preferred structure. - Facilitation and organisation of workshop(s) with the fishing industry and other stakeholders to identify potential projects which could be supported by the fund and to ensure the fund is accessible to the fishing industry.
